Viewing distance guidance for clear driver response
Fit the sign where approaching drivers can read it before they commit to parking. For a 400 x 300mm sign, allow roughly 8–12 metres in open private areas, with closer placement near bends, gates or tight entrances.
| Size option | Suggested viewing range | Typical use |
|---|---|---|
| H 400 x W 300mm | Approx. 8–12 metres | Posts, gates, fencing and private car park entrances |

Fitting advice for No Parking signs on posts and fencing
- ❌ Do not fit it behind parked vehicles where drivers see it too late.
- ❌ Do not mount it so low that bumpers, bins or weeds hide the message.
- ❌ Do not angle it away from the direction drivers approach from.
- ❌ Do not rely on it for legally controlled public-road restrictions.
- ❌ Do not use it alone where marked bays need detailed parking rules.
- ❌ Do not choose non-reflective signage for poorly lit night-only control.
- ✅ Use all four holes so wind cannot twist the sign on the post.
- ✅ Position it before the obstruction point, not after it.
- ✅ Check sightlines from a driver’s seat before leaving the area.
No Parking Post Mount Signs questions answered
What are No Parking Post Mount Signs used for? They are used to tell drivers not to park in a specific private area, such as a gate, yard entrance, fence line, private road or car park access point.
Can I use this sign on a public road? No. This style is intended for private premises control. Public highway parking restrictions need authorised traffic signs and road markings.
Are cable ties enough to fit the sign securely? Yes, for many posts and wire fences, provided the sign is fixed tightly through all pre-drilled holes and checked after bad weather or repeated contact.
Where should I place it for best driver response? Place it where drivers decide whether to stop, ideally facing approaching vehicles before they reach a gate, bay, access route or turning point.
Is this No Parking post sign suitable outdoors? Yes. The rigid polypropylene material, satin finish and cable-tie fixing method make it suitable for outdoor private parking and access-control areas.
